How Do CPUs and GPUs Work Together to Power Modern Technology?

A Dynamic Duo Powering Modern Technology

CPUs and GPUs: 

In the ever-evolving landscape of computing, one misconception persists: that GPUs (Graphics Processing Units) are poised to replace CPUs (Central Processing Units). The reality is far more nuanced and exciting. Rather than competing, these two technologies work in harmony, each playing a distinct role in powering everything from smartphones to supercomputers. 

Let’s explore how this partnership works and why it’s critical to the future of tech.

The CPU: Master of Complexity

CPUs are the brains of most computing systems. Designed for sequential processing, they excel at handling complex, linear tasks that require quick decision-making. Think of a CPU as a meticulous librarian: it processes instructions one after another, managing everything from your operating system’s logic to app multitasking.

Key Strengths

  • High clock speeds (3–5 GHz) for rapid task execution
  • Fewer cores (4–16 in consumer devices) optimized for versatility
  • Manages critical workflows like security, I/O operations, and system coordination

Without CPUs, modern computing would grind to a halt. They are the backbone of general-purpose processing.

The GPU: Parallel Powerhouse

GPUs, originally designed for rendering graphics, have evolved into specialists for parallel workloads. Unlike CPUs, GPUs tackle thousands of smaller tasks simultaneously, making them ideal for data-heavy applications. Imagine a GPU as a team of construction workers: while each worker handles a simple task, together they build something massive and fast.

Key Strengths

  • Thousands of smaller, efficient cores (e.g., NVIDIA’s A100 has 6,912 cores)
  • Optimized for matrix operations, vector calculations, and pixel rendering
  • Dominates AI training, video rendering, and scientific simulations

GPUs thrive in scenarios where “divide and conquer” is the golden rule.

CPU vs. GPU: A Symbiotic Relationship

CPUs master sequential tasks, managing system-wide logic and offering low latency and high precision. GPUs, on the other hand, dominate parallel tasks, providing high throughput and scalability.

For example, in gaming, the CPU handles physics, NPC behavior, and game logic, while the GPU renders lifelike graphics at high frame rates.

How They Collaborate: Real-World Applications

AI and Machine Learning

  • The CPU preprocesses data and manages training pipelines.
  • The GPU accelerates neural network training with frameworks like TensorFlow and PyTorch.

Supercomputing

  • Systems like Frontier, the world’s fastest supercomputer, combine AMD CPUs and GPUs to simulate climate models and discover new drugs.

Smartphones

  • Apple’s A-series chips integrate CPU and GPU cores for seamless AR, photography, and multitasking.

Autonomous Vehicles

  • CPUs make real-time driving decisions, while GPUs process sensor and camera data from LiDAR and radar.

The Future: Unified but Specialized

The line between CPUs and GPUs is blurring, but their specialization remains vital.

  • Heterogeneous Computing: Combining CPU and GPU strengths in a single system, such as AMD’s Ryzen processors with integrated Radeon graphics.
  • Advancements in APIs: Tools like CUDA and OpenCL streamline cross-processor collaboration.
  • Edge Computing: Lightweight devices like drones rely on both processors for real-time analytics.

Conclusion

CPUs and GPUs aren’t rivals—they’re partners. As demands for AI, real-time data, and immersive experiences grow, their collaboration will only deepen. Whether you’re scrolling through social media or analyzing black holes, this dynamic duo is working behind the scenes to make it possible.

References

Let’s celebrate the harmony of hardware!

🌐 Home | Blog | About Us | Contact| Resources

📱 Follow us: @RiseNinspireHub

© 2025 Rise&Inspire. All Rights Reserved.

Word Count:563

Why Are GPUs and TPUs Vital for Developing AI that Speaks and Writes Like Humans?

What Makes GPUs and TPUs Essential for Teaching AI to Understand Human Language?

How Do GPUs and TPUs Collaborate to Train Advanced Language Models?

GPUs vs. TPUs: Powering LLM Training

Introduction

Imagine teaching a computer to understand and speak human language almost like a person. This incredible feat is made possible by two types of powerful technology: Graphics Processing Units (GPUs) and Tensor Processing Units (TPUs). These specialized tools are essential for training Large Language Models (LLMs), enabling computers to read, write, and comprehend vast amounts of text with remarkable accuracy.

But what exactly do GPUs and TPUs do differently, and how do they work together to handle such complex tasks?

Let’s inquire into the world of AI hardware to uncover how these technologies drive the future of language understanding and communication.

To handle the vast amount of data and complex computations required to train LLMs, specialized hardware is essential. Two of the most critical types of hardware in this domain are Graphics Processing Units (GPUs) and Tensor Processing Units (TPUs). Both play a significant role in the training process, but they have distinct characteristics and advantages.

GPUs (Graphics Processing Units)

GPUs were originally designed to handle the parallel processing required for rendering graphics in video games and simulations. However, their ability to perform many calculations simultaneously makes them ideal for the parallelized nature of deep learning tasks.

1. Parallel Processing: GPUs can perform thousands of operations concurrently, making them highly efficient for training neural networks, where multiple calculations must be done at once.

2. Flexibility: GPUs are versatile and can be used for a wide range of tasks beyond graphics and deep learning, including scientific simulations and financial modeling.

3. Wide Adoption: GPU technology is well-established, with extensive support from frameworks like TensorFlow and PyTorch, making it easier for researchers to leverage them for LLM training.

TPUs (Tensor Processing Units)

TPUs are custom-built by Google specifically for machine learning tasks. They are designed to accelerate the computations needed for neural networks, offering distinct advantages for deep learning.

1. Purpose-Built for AI: TPUs are optimized for the specific matrix and vector computations involved in neural networks, allowing for faster and more efficient processing.

2. Scalability: TPUs can be scaled more easily across large clusters, making them ideal for handling the enormous datasets and model sizes of LLMs.

3. Energy Efficiency: TPUs tend to be more energy-efficient compared to GPUs, reducing the overall cost and environmental impact of training large models.

The Role of GPUs and TPUs in LLM Training

Training LLMs on hundreds of billions of words involves massive amounts of data and extensive computations, making both GPUs and TPUs crucial:

1. Data Processing: GPUs and TPUs process the input data through multiple layers of the neural network, performing complex mathematical operations in parallel to learn patterns and features from the data.

2. Model Updates: During training, the model’s parameters are updated continuously based on the errors in its predictions. This requires significant computational power, which GPUs and TPUs provide efficiently.

3. Scalability: As models grow larger and datasets become more extensive, the ability to scale across multiple GPUs or TPUs is essential. This parallelism helps speed up the training process, making it feasible to train sophisticated models like GPT-4 within a reasonable time frame.

Conclusion

The training of Large Language Models is a feat of modern engineering, relying heavily on the advanced capabilities of GPUs and TPUs. These powerful processors enable the handling of vast datasets and complex computations, making it possible to develop AI models that can understand and generate human language with unprecedented accuracy. By leveraging the strengths of both GPUs and TPUs, researchers can push the boundaries of what’s possible in natural language processing, opening up new possibilities for AI applications.

Source: OpenAI

Source: Google AI Blog

Source: Wired

Key Takeaway

GPUs and TPUs are essential for training Large Language Models (LLMs), each offering distinct advantages. GPUs excel in parallel processing, making them versatile for various tasks beyond deep learning, while TPUs are purpose-built for AI, offering superior efficiency and scalability. Together, they enable the handling of vast datasets and complex computations, pushing the boundaries of what’s possible in natural language processing and AI applications.

Explore more insights and inspiration on my platform, Rise&InspireHub. Visit my blog for more stories that touch the heart and spark the imagination.

Email: kjbtrs@riseandinspire.co.in